IF I ZOOM IN OR OUT, THE MAIN CAMERA, LIGHT 4 MOVES TOO !!!.. HOW CAN I CHANGE THAT ?
As I said to you, the super-lights are aimed to the main camera : If you zoom in, manually, the spot moves too !
If you want just moves the camera, and not the spot, do like this :
- Select the main camera in the PREVIEW options,
- Open the parameters panel (for the main camera),
- Increase or decrease the camera focal, to zoom in or zoom out, in your scene.
And now, the Light 4 won't moves in the scene : only the camera's view !
I WANT TO USE SUPER-LIGHTS WITH ANOTHER CAMERA, THAN THE MAIN CAMERA... HOW CAN I DO ?
You can easily use the MAIN CAMERA to do like the POSING CAMERA or the FACE CAMERA :
For a POSING CAMERA :
- Select the MAIN CAMERA in the PREVIEW options,
- Open the parameters panel and increase the focal, to zoom in on the character, and then, selected him in the PREVIEW options.
Now, you can turn around him, as the POSING CAMERA, with no problem.
For a FACE CAMERA :
- Select the MAIN CAMERA in the PREVIEW window,
- In the parameters panel, choose : 500, for the focal of the camera.
- After, increase the DOLLY Y parameter to up the camera, until you have the face of your character, in the PREVIEW window.
- Selected him in the PREVIEW options, and now you can use the button to turn at right or left.
And that's done : the light won't change in your scene... Don't forgot to use the focal, to zoom in or zoom out, anyway.
THE LIGHTS SEEMS TO ME TOO DULL... CAN I CHANGE THAT ?
I made SUPER-LIGHTS to avoid shining skin and awful dark shadow on the characters skin.
Each super-light will give you sweet shadows, and only a dark shadow on the ground !
So, changing the shadows parameters is inappropriate, and it's not advisable !
But if you find your scene is not lightning enough, you can do like this :
- Select the LIGHT 4,
- open its parameters panel,
- and increase the power of light (it's 50 % by default - to give you the possibility to increase this light as you want).
CAN I USE THE SUPER-LIGHTS WITH ANOTHER CAMERA ?
Yes, of course. You can use Super-Lights with any camera you want !
But, the lights don't follow the camera, in this case.
LIGHT 4 can be annoying to use with another camera than the MAIN CAMERA, so the best thing to do is that :
- Select LIGHT 4,
- Open the properties panel,
- And choose "Set Parent" to : GROUND.
Now, you can move LIGHT 4 easier... with no problem.
HOW CAN I CHANGE THE COLORS OF THE SUPER-LIGHTS, TO BE LIKE MY BACKGROUND ?
I recommend to change only 2 lights.
So, you need to change only the LIGHT 3 and LIGHT 4...
Always do like this :
- Choose (with the pipette) a clear color from the background... and apply it to the LIGHT 4 !
- Choose (with the pipette) a dark color from the background (but not black color)... and apply it to the LIGHT 3.
Then, you will have the same colorful of light as your background, where your characters will be perfectly included in the scene colors' tone !
You can adjust the power of the light, by increasing the intensity parameter for LIGHT 4, if you want.
